  VH1.com : Longpigs : Biography - Urge Music Downloads
Although they were signed to a major label just months after playing their first gig, the band were crushed when the label went under, especially since a new label would have to pay £500,000 to release them from their contract.
Their single "Far" hit the U.K. Top 40 in early 1996, followed by the Top 20 entry "On and On." Their debut album, The Sun Is Often Out, was released in the U.K. in April 1996, and in America less than one year later.
Longpigs toured with U2 as well, opening for the group on selected dates of their 1997 Popmart Tour.

 The Longpigs -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
The Longpigs were a British band who rose to fame on the fringe of Britpop in the 1990s; comprising Crispin Hunt (vocals), Richard Hawley (guitar), Simon Stafford (bass) and former Cabaret Voltaire member Dee Boyle (drums).
Shortly after, the UK arm of the record label closed its doors leaving the Longpigs' future in doubt.
The Longpigs contract was purchased by U2's new record label, Mother Records.

 Richard Hawley -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Richard Hawley, (born Sheffield, England) is a critically acclaimed guitarist, singer, songwriter and producer.
Hawley initially found success as a member of Britpop band The Longpigs in the 1990s.
When a drug-filled torpor after an extensive tour of America brought the band to the brink of extinction in 1997, Hawley was asked to play with Pulp by his close friend and Pulp frontman Jarvis Cocker.
